Q: Is 32,130,996 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 32,130,996 is not a prime number.

Why is 32,130,996 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 32130996 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 12 2,677,583 5,355,166 8,032,749 10,710,332 16,065,498 and 32,130,996, with no remainder.

Since 32,130,996 cannot be divided by just 1 and 32,130,996, it is not a prime number.
